引言
本文全面讨论 TPWallet(或同类非托管钱包)如何进行加密保护,结合实时资产监控、科技动态、区块链创新、矿工费估算、智能化数据处理、高效支付技术与高级身份验证,给出设计选择与安全实践建议。
一、核心加密机制
1. 私钥与助记词保护:采用 BIP39 助记词结合用户口令(BIP39 passphrase)或对助记词做本地对称加密(例如 AES-GCM),口令通过 KDF(PBKDF2 / scrypt / Argon2)派生密钥,增加暴力破解成本。确保高质量熵源和安全的随机数生成器。
2. HD 钱包与密钥派生:使用 BIP32/BIP44 等分层确定性结构,主种子加密后仅在需要时解密并在内存中使用,避免长期明文存放。

3. 密钥文件与 keystore:采用加盐与 KDF 的 keystore JSON 格式(参照 Ethereum keystore),加密算法与参数可配置以抵抗未来算力提升。
4. 硬件与受信任执行环境:优先使用 Secure Element、TEE、硬件钱包或 HSM 来隔离私钥签名操作,减少主机被攻破后的风险。
5. 门限签名与多方计算(MPC):对https://www.onmcis.com ,企业或高价值用户,采用阈值签名或 MPC 方案实现无单点私钥暴露与灵活的社复救援。

二、传输与存储安全
对链上交互使用 TLS、证书校验与签名验证;应用层对敏感数据进行端到端加密。云端仅存储加密后的备份,密钥派生参数和加密元数据需完整保存以便恢复。
三、实时资产监控与智能告警
构建本地区块链索引器或使用可靠第三方 API,结合 mempool 监听实现未确认交易和双花风险检测。资产变化、异常流出模式采用基于规则与机器学习的告警机制,结合速率限制与自动化交易冻结策略。
四、矿工费估算与交易提交优化
1. 供应端策略:基于最新区块、mempool 状态和链上交易确认时间分布,使用统计模型或 ML 模型预测不同费率下的确认概率。兼容 EIP-1559 的 baseFee 与 tip 估算,支持分层策略(立即确认、节省费用、可延迟)。
2. 批处理与打包:对代币转账或合约调用采用批量打包、sequence reuse 规避重复 gas 消耗;对 L2 或跨链采用桥接优化策略。
五、智能化数据处理与区块链创新适配
通过实时 ETL、向量化存储与 ML 推理(如行为聚类、异常检测、价格喂价校验)提升监控与风控效率。关注 Layer2、zk-rollup、account abstraction 的演进,适配新签名方案与隐私证明技术(zk-SNARK/zk-STARK)以兼顾可扩展性与隐私保护。
六、高效支付技术
采用状态通道、闪电/支付通道、批量结算和 rollup 聚合来降低手续费与提升吞吐;在链外与链上之间平衡资金在途时间与对手风险。支持多币种原子交换与智能路由提升用户体验。
七、高级身份验证与恢复
1. 多因子与无密码:结合设备绑定、软硬件双因素、WebAuthn/FIDO2 与生物识别实现便捷又强韧的登录与签名授权。
2. 社会恢复与分布式备份:采用 Shamir Secret Sharing 或社会恢复、MPC 恢复等方案,在丢失设备时通过预设信任圈或阈值签名恢复资助。
八、隐私与合规
在设计中平衡隐私(UTXO CoinJoin、zk 技术)与合规(KYC/AML、可审计性)。提供可选的隐私模式并保留审计日志的最小化策略。
九、工程实践与运维建议
持续渗透测试、外部审计、密钥生命周期管理、软硬件补丁策略和备份演练;在 UX 层面清晰向用户展示加密与恢复风险,教育用户助记词与口令管理。
结论
TPWallet 类钱包的加密设计应在密钥安全、可用性与性能间取得平衡。结合硬件隔离、现代 KDF、门限签名、实时监控与 ML 驱动的风控,配合高效支付通道与先进身份验证,可以把非托管钱包的安全性和用户体验提升到企业级水准。同时应持续跟踪区块链与加密技术的创新并快速迭代安全策略。